Saint Michael Chapel

The Saint Michael Church is a Gothic style church in , . Originally a chapel, the building became officially a church after its reconstruction in 2006.

The Cathedral of St. Elizabeth, also called Saint Elizabeth Cathedral, is a Gothic cathedral in , . It is the largest church in Slovakia and one of the easternmost Gothic cathedrals in Europe.

The is situated in the centre of , . The representative building of the State Theatre was built in a Neo-baroque style according to projects of Adolf Lang during the years 1879–1899. is situated 220 metres north of Saint Michael Chapel.
